I Share Your Pains, Buhari Assures Chibok Girls’ Parents

President Buhari's wife, Aisha, Wails along with mothers of Chibok GirlsPresident Muhammadu Buhari has assured parents and relations of the kidnapped Chibok girls that he frequently reflects on the ordeal of the captives in the hands of Boko Haram terrorists and shares the pain of their continued absence from home.
On the second anniversary of the kidnap of the girls, President Buhari affirmed that, as a parent and leader of the country, he understands the torment, frustration and anxiety of the parents and will not spare any effort to ensure the safe return of the girls.
The President said that he believed that with the total commitment of the Federal Government, Nigerian Armed Forces and security agencies, and the support of the international community, the girls will be eventually rescued.
President Buhari said that thousands of persons, mostly women and children, who were kidnapped by Boko Haram, have already been rescued and reunited with their families, stressing that he hoped that the Chibok girls will ultimately be rescued and reunited with their families as well.
He called on the parents to continue to exercise patience and understanding as the government works diligently to ensure that the girls return home unharmed even as he thanked all Nigerians, religious and civil organizations, as well as the international community for their continued sympathy, support and prayers for the return of the Chibok girls.
